The popularity of Voice over Internet Protocol (VoIP) is increasing in popularity. Those who use their computers for virtually everything can now also use them to make and receive telephone calls. Many providers of residential VoIP services offer competitive packages, excellent customer service, and features that you already receive with your traditional phone service provider. In order to use residential VoIP services you need to have a high-speed Internet connection. If you have a slower connection, the quality of your calls greatly diminishes. You will also need a modem and adapter that connects your phone line to your computer. The majority of VoIP services provide this in their packages.
There are two different types of VoIP for residential use: hardware VoIP and software VoIP. The primary difference is that with hardware VoIP you will need an adapter to connect your phone to your computer. With software VoIP, you install a special program for making and receiving calls with your computer. Whether you use hardware VoIP or software VoIP it is certain you will save money over using your traditional phone service.
Software VoIP works well if you were going to occasional use it or if you were traveling. You can have it installed on your laptop and take it with you. You can make calls from anywhere with your home number. Another benefit of software VoIP is that you can get very low International rates. Most providers of this type of service allow you to download the software free once you have established an account with them. All you need for this type of service is a computer with a sound card, speakers, and a microphone. With most services, all calls made within the network are free and you only pay for calls made outside the network.
Hardware VoIP looks much like your traditional phone as you use can use your phone. You connect your phone line into an adapter, which then connects to the computer. This type of plan typically offers limited calling plans throughout the United States and Canada or unlimited calling features.
Remember that residential VoIP services run on electricity so it would be wise to have a back-up plan in case the power went out. Do not sign a contract without fully understanding the charges that apply. Carefully review the plans that are offered and no whether you will pay a penalty if you decide to cancel the service. Check to see if there is an installment fee or fee for the equipment. Once you have decided on your residential VoIP provider - enjoy the new world of making calls from your computer.
Voip Software For Mobile
Voice over Internet Protocol (VoIP) software, simply speaking is software that allows you to make calls from your computer over the Internet as opposed to the Public Service Telephone Network (PSTN). It is gaining in popularity due to the convenience and decrease for money that the customer has to pay for Internet and phone service. There are several providers of VoIP software and each has a variety of plans to choose from that can be either free or as costly as $49.95 per month. There is VoIP software for both residential and business consumers. One major benefit that many people enjoy with VoIP software is low International rates. This article will look at five reasons you should switch to VoIP software for your telephone and Internet needs.
* Bottom line is your pocket book - VoIP software plans are less expensive than traditional phone service. When you switch your phone service over to VoIP, you are taking advantage of the broadband network to meet to needs; phone and Internet thus, lowering your monthly bill.
* VoIP software packages offer competitive rates for local, long distance, and International calls. You can choose between limited and unlimited local calling, limited and unlimited calling in the United States and Canada, and most plans offer significantly lower rates on International calls than you would pay through your traditional phone service provider.
* The majority of users enjoy free calling features that they were accustom to using in their daily lives with traditional phone service. Those features include voicemail, call forwarding and waiting, caller ID, and much more. For added convenience users of VoIP software can choose to have their voicemail messages sent directly to their email. In addition, several VoIP software packages are compatible with Outlook and other computer applications, which allows for effective managing of both incoming and outgoing calls.
* Who does not enjoy convenience and this is an optimal word when it comes to using VoIP software for your phone needs. You are not required to buy fancy equipment that is cumbersome to connect. You can use you traditional phone and connect it to an adapter that then connects the signal to the computer. The adapter is many times provided free of charge through your chosen provider for VoIP services.
* For those of you who love to travel you will enjoy the ability to take your phone anywhere in the world and still have access to calls at no additional cost. Your phone number anywhere you go, as long as there is a high-speed Internet connection, you can take your phone worldwide.
